I'd like to see more skins for the female characters

All our armours fit all our characters. We don't have "male-only" or "female-only" armours or microtransactions, and I really don't think this will change.

If you want tighter-fitting, or less bulky armours, that's not unreasonable (especially for Dex-aligned builds), but bear in mind these armours need to fit all the character classes.
